Comprehending Different Karate Styles



When you begin checking out martial arts, understanding the different styles can substantially enhance your training experience. Each style has one-of-a-kind methods, ideologies, and concentrates.

As an example, Shotokan emphasizes powerful strikes and direct activities, while Goju-Ryu blends hard and soft methods, incorporating round motions. If you choose a much more fluid technique, think about Wado-Ryu, which focuses on evasion and harmony.



Kyokushin, on the other hand, is understood for its full-contact sparring and strenuous training program. As you assess your rate of interests and objectives, think of what resonates with you most.

Whether you seek self-defense, fitness, or self-control, picking a style that straightens with your ambitions will certainly maintain you motivated and involved. Dive into courses to experience these styles direct and find what fits you best.

Evaluating Trainers and Training Environments



As you search for the best karate classes, reviewing trainers and training environments is important for your success and comfort.

Beginning by observing the instructors' credentials and experience. A qualified trainer shouldn't just have expertise in karate however additionally have solid teaching abilities. Search for someone that interacts plainly and reveals real interest in their trainees' development.

Next, examine the training setting. Is the dojo clean, organized, and safe? Think about the class size; smaller classes often enable more personalized attention.

Take note of the environment-- does it really feel inviting and encouraging? Finally, don't wait to ask existing students concerning their experiences. Their understandings can give valuable information to aid you make the most effective choice for your martial arts trip.
